Qatar Airways has increased Berlin flights

Oneworld member Qatar Airways has increased non-stop service between Berlin and Doha. Up to eleven weekly circulations have been offered since October 2, 2022. Boeing 787-8 and 787-9 long-haul jets are used.

The route is offered twice a day from Berlin-Brandenburg on up to four days a week. There is currently increased demand due to the upcoming soccer World Cup. Special entry regulations apply around the event. In the period from November 1st to December 23rd, entry into the country is only possible with the so-called Hayya card.

“Qatar Airways’ significant increase in the flight offer to Doha strengthens the connectivity of BER. Important travel destinations and markets in Asia, Australia and Africa are now even easier to reach via Doha. This is a strong signal for the long-distance routes at BER and the connection to the region," says BER boss Aletta von Massenbach.
